F0561
D

Failure to Honor Resident Bathing Preferences and Facility Bathing Policy

Dublin, Ohio Survey Completed on 05-15-2025

Summary

A deficiency was identified when a resident with diagnoses including cerebral infarction, acute respiratory failure with hypoxia, dysphasia, and bilateral paralysis, who had no cognitive deficits and required assistance for transfers and activities of daily living, was not provided with bathing opportunities in accordance with facility policy and her expressed preferences. The resident reported not receiving routine showers twice a week and not being offered bed baths between scheduled shower days. She also stated that staff would not assist with her hair care due to its length, requiring her to wait for her sister to visit for grooming. Review of the resident's medical record and facility documentation confirmed that only four showers were provided over a period of approximately three weeks, with no documentation available to verify additional showers or bed baths. Facility policy required that residents be offered showers at least twice weekly and bed baths daily, but this was not consistently documented or provided for the resident in question. Interviews with the DON and Regional Nurse confirmed the expectation for regular bathing and acknowledged the lack of compliance with facility protocols.
